Figura 2.3 Ventana de programación.
STEP 7-Micro/WIN incorpora los tres editores de programas siguientes: Esquema de
contactos (KOP), Lista de instrucciones (AWL) y Diagrama de funciones (FUP). Con
algunas restricciones, los programas creados con uno de estos editores se pueden
visualizar y editar con los demás.
Funciones del editor AWL
El editor AWL visualiza el programa textualmente. Permite crear programas de control
introduciendo la nemotécnica de las operaciones. El editor AWL sirve para crear ciertos
programas que, de otra forma, no se podrían programar con los editores KOP ni FUP.
Ello se debe a que AWL es el lenguaje nativo del S7-200, a diferencia de los editores
gráficos, sujetos a ciertas restricciones para poder dibujar los diagramas correctamente.
El S7-200 ejecuta cada operación en el orden determinado por el programa, de arriba a
abajo, reiniciando después arriba. AWL utiliza una pila lógica para resolver la lógica de
control. El usuario inserta las operaciones AWL para procesar las LD I0.0 //Leer una
entrada A I0.1 //AND con otra entrada = Q0.0 //Escribir en el valor en //la salida 1
operaciones de pila. Considere los siguientes aspectos importantes cuando desee utilizar
el editor AWL:
- El lenguaje AWL es más apropiado para los programadores expertos.
- En algunos casos, AWL permite solucionar problemas que no se podrían resolver
fácilmente con los editores KOP o FUP.
- El editor AWL soporta sólo el juego de operaciones SIMATIC.
- En tanto que el editor AWL se puede utilizar siempre para ver o editar programas
creados con los editores KOP o FUP, lo contrario no es posible en todos los casos. Los
editores KOP o FUP no siempre se pueden utilizar para visualizar un programa que se
haya creado en AWL.
11